当前位置:首页 > 科技 > 正文

分布式一致性协议与蜂窝网络:交织的数字脉络

  • 科技
  • 2025-05-05 16:43:13
  • 4629
摘要: # 引言在当今这个高度互联的世界里,分布式一致性协议与蜂窝网络如同两条交织的数字脉络,共同编织着我们日常生活的方方面面。它们不仅在技术层面上相互影响,更在社会层面推动着信息的流动与共享。本文将深入探讨这两者之间的联系,揭示它们如何共同塑造了现代通信的面貌。...

# 引言

在当今这个高度互联的世界里,分布式一致性协议与蜂窝网络如同两条交织的数字脉络,共同编织着我们日常生活的方方面面。它们不仅在技术层面上相互影响,更在社会层面推动着信息的流动与共享。本文将深入探讨这两者之间的联系,揭示它们如何共同塑造了现代通信的面貌。

# 分布式一致性协议:构建信任的基石

分布式一致性协议是确保分布式系统中多个节点能够达成一致状态的一系列算法。这些协议在区块链、分布式数据库、云计算等领域发挥着至关重要的作用。它们通过复杂的数学模型和算法,确保即使在网络中存在故障或恶意行为的情况下,系统也能保持稳定和可靠。

## 一致性协议的种类

1. Paxos算法:Paxos算法是一种经典的分布式一致性协议,它通过多轮投票机制确保所有节点达成一致。Paxos算法的核心在于“提案”和“接受”两个阶段,通过这种方式,即使有节点失败或被恶意攻击,系统也能保持稳定。

2. Raft算法:Raft算法是Paxos算法的一个简化版本,它通过更直观的领导选举机制来实现一致性。Raft算法将一致性问题简化为三个阶段:领导者选举、日志复制和跟随者同步,使得理解和实现更加容易。

3. Zab协议:Zab协议是Apache Zookeeper中使用的分布式一致性协议,它结合了Paxos和Raft的优点,能够在高并发场景下保持高效和稳定。

## 一致性协议的应用

- 区块链技术:区块链系统依赖于分布式一致性协议来确保交易的不可篡改性和安全性。通过共识机制,区块链能够实现多个节点之间的信任和一致性。

- 分布式数据库:在分布式数据库中,一致性协议确保数据在多个节点之间的一致性,即使在节点故障或网络延迟的情况下也能保持数据的一致性。

- 云计算平台:云计算平台中的分布式服务需要通过一致性协议来确保服务的可靠性和稳定性。例如,阿里云的分布式服务框架就采用了多种一致性协议来保证服务的高可用性和一致性。

分布式一致性协议与蜂窝网络:交织的数字脉络

# 蜂窝网络:连接世界的桥梁

蜂窝网络是现代通信系统的核心组成部分,它通过无线信号将用户设备与互联网连接起来。蜂窝网络不仅提供了高速的数据传输,还支持语音通话、视频流媒体等多种服务。随着5G技术的普及,蜂窝网络正朝着更高的速度、更低的延迟和更大的连接密度发展。

## 蜂窝网络的架构

蜂窝网络由多个基站(基站、微基站、宏基站等)组成,这些基站通过无线信号覆盖特定的地理区域。用户设备(手机、平板电脑等)通过与最近的基站建立连接,实现与互联网的通信。蜂窝网络的架构可以分为以下几个层次:

1. 接入层:负责用户设备与基站之间的无线信号传输。

分布式一致性协议与蜂窝网络:交织的数字脉络

2. 控制层:负责基站之间的协调和管理,确保信号的有效覆盖和传输。

3. 核心层:负责用户数据的路由和转发,实现与互联网的连接。

## 蜂窝网络的技术演进

- 2G:第二代蜂窝网络技术,主要提供语音通话服务。

- 3G:第三代蜂窝网络技术,引入了数据传输功能,支持网页浏览、短信等服务。

分布式一致性协议与蜂窝网络:交织的数字脉络

- 4G:第四代蜂窝网络技术,实现了高速数据传输,支持高清视频通话、在线游戏等服务。

- 5G:第五代蜂窝网络技术,提供了更高的速度、更低的延迟和更大的连接密度。5G技术不仅支持高速数据传输,还为物联网、自动驾驶等新兴应用提供了强大的支持。

# 分布式一致性协议与蜂窝网络的交织

分布式一致性协议与蜂窝网络之间的联系是多方面的。首先,分布式一致性协议在蜂窝网络中发挥着关键作用,确保了网络中各个节点之间的数据一致性和可靠性。其次,蜂窝网络为分布式一致性协议提供了物理层的支持,使得这些协议能够在实际应用中得以实现。

## 分布式一致性协议在蜂窝网络中的应用

分布式一致性协议与蜂窝网络:交织的数字脉络

1. 基站间的协调:分布式一致性协议可以用于基站之间的协调和管理,确保信号的有效覆盖和传输。例如,通过Paxos算法或Raft算法,基站可以实现对信号覆盖区域的动态调整,从而提高网络的稳定性和可靠性。

2. 用户数据的一致性:在蜂窝网络中,用户数据需要在多个基站之间进行传输和存储。分布式一致性协议可以确保这些数据在不同基站之间的一致性,即使在节点故障或网络延迟的情况下也能保持数据的一致性。

3. 物联网应用:随着物联网技术的发展,蜂窝网络需要支持大量的设备连接和数据传输。分布式一致性协议可以确保这些设备之间的数据一致性和可靠性,从而提高物联网应用的稳定性和安全性。

## 蜂窝网络对分布式一致性协议的影响

1. 物理层的支持:蜂窝网络为分布式一致性协议提供了物理层的支持,使得这些协议能够在实际应用中得以实现。例如,通过无线信号传输和基站之间的协调,分布式一致性协议可以在实际应用中实现数据的一致性和可靠性。

分布式一致性协议与蜂窝网络:交织的数字脉络

2. 网络拓扑的变化:随着蜂窝网络技术的发展,网络拓扑结构也在不断变化。分布式一致性协议需要适应这些变化,以确保在网络拓扑结构发生变化时仍然能够保持数据的一致性和可靠性。

3. 性能要求的提高:随着蜂窝网络技术的发展,对性能的要求也在不断提高。分布式一致性协议需要不断提高性能,以满足这些要求。例如,通过优化算法和提高计算效率,分布式一致性协议可以在高并发场景下保持高效和稳定。

# 结论

分布式一致性协议与蜂窝网络之间的联系是复杂而深刻的。它们不仅在技术层面上相互影响,更在社会层面推动着信息的流动与共享。通过深入理解这两者之间的联系,我们可以更好地利用它们的优势,推动通信技术的发展和应用。未来,随着技术的不断进步,分布式一致性协议与蜂窝网络将更加紧密地交织在一起,共同塑造一个更加互联、智能的世界。